  &lt;h2&gt;Blackbutt Flooring FAQ&lt;/h2&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     How do you clean blackbutt timber floors?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Clean blackbutt timber floors with a dry or lightly damp microfibre mop. Avoid saturating the surface with water. Use a pH-neutral timber floor cleaner — never steam mops or harsh chemicals, which can strip the protective polyurethane coating. Sweep or vacuum first to remove grit. Lifewood's prefinished Blackbutt floors with 9-layer UV coating are designed to be low-maintenance and easy to care for.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     What colours go with blackbutt floors?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Blackbutt's warm honey-blonde tones pair beautifully with white, off-white, and light grey walls, creating the bright, contemporary look seen in this Mandurah project. White cabinetry is a classic match. Warm terracotta, sage green, and navy blue accents also work well with blackbutt's natural warmth. Its versatility means it suits both contemporary and coastal interior styles equally well.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     Can I mix spotted gum and blackbutt flooring?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Mixing spotted gum and blackbutt flooring in the same home is possible but requires careful planning. Both are Australian hardwoods, but their colours differ — spotted gum has stronger grey and brown tones, while blackbutt is warmer and lighter. If mixing, consider using them in separate rooms or zones rather than adjoining areas. Our design consultants can advise the best approach for your specific floor plan.&lt;/p&gt;

   &lt;h2&gt;Exquisitely Red — The Timeless Beauty of Jarrah&lt;/h2&gt; 
   &lt;p&gt;Jarrah (Eucalyptus marginata) is unique to the south-western corner of Western Australia. Its rich red tones with underlying brown and blonde hues create a natural colour palette that has graced Australian homes for over 150 years — and continues to look as beautiful today as ever.&lt;/p&gt; 
   &lt;p&gt;In this Claremont renovation, our client made an inspired design choice: white walls, traditional skirting and cabinetry, all complemented beautifully by Jarrah's deep warm tones. The result is a home that feels both timeless and distinctly Australian — the ideal marriage of classic architecture and natural materials.&lt;/p&gt; 
   &lt;p&gt;Jarrah timber flooring's deep red colour is also a natural sign of the timber's density and durability. With a Janka hardness rating of approximately 8.5 kN, Jarrah is one of the toughest native Australian timbers available for flooring.&lt;/p&gt;

  &lt;h2&gt;Jarrah Flooring FAQ&lt;/h2&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     Is jarrah flooring good for kitchens?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Yes — jarrah timber flooring performs very well in kitchens. Its natural hardness (Janka rating around 8.5 kN) resists dents and scratches from everyday foot traffic. Lifewood's prefinished Jarrah boards come with 9-layer UV-protective polyurethane coating, making them easy to clean and resistant to moisture from spills when properly maintained. This Claremont project included the kitchen as one of the primary jarrah flooring areas.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     How do you clean jarrah floors?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Clean jarrah floors regularly with a dry or slightly damp microfibre mop. Avoid saturating the timber with water. Use a pH-neutral timber floor cleaner and never use steam mops or harsh chemical cleaners, which can strip the protective coating. Sweep or vacuum first to remove grit that could scratch the surface. Lifewood's prefinished boards are designed to be low-maintenance and easy to care for.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     What colours go with jarrah floors?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Jarrah's rich red-brown tones pair beautifully with white or off-white walls, creating the classic contrast seen in traditional Australian homes like this Claremont project. Neutral greys, warm creams, and dark charcoal work equally well. Darker timber tones in cabinetry complement jarrah's natural warmth. Steer away from stark blue-whites, which can clash with jarrah's warm red undertones.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     What furniture goes with jarrah floors?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Jarrah floors suit traditional and contemporary furniture equally well. Lighter upholstery and pale timber furniture create a bright, airy contrast. Darker wood furniture in walnut or blackwood tones complements jarrah's warm red hues. Brass or copper metal accents in light fittings and handles work particularly well with jarrah's warm palette.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     Can you stain jarrah flooring lighter?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Staining jarrah lighter is challenging due to the timber's natural tannins and density. Jarrah is quite resistant to penetrating stains, and attempting to lighten it significantly can result in uneven colour. Most flooring specialists recommend embracing jarrah's natural red-brown warmth. Lifewood's prefinished Jarrah boards are finished with a semi-gloss UV-protective coating that enhances the timber's natural colour rather than masking it.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     What is Stabilised Solid® jarrah flooring?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Stabilised Solid® is Lifewood's patented flooring technology, engineered to eliminate the cupping, gapping, and twisting common in traditional solid timber floors. Each board is kiln-dried, acclimatised, and precision-machined before prefinishing with 9 coats of UV-protective polyurethane. The result is a genuine solid timber floor — not engineered — that performs with the dimensional stability of a floating floor.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     How long does jarrah timber flooring take to install?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Installation time depends on the area size and complexity. For this Claremont renovation project covering entry, passage, kitchen, living room, and dining room, Lifewood's team completed the installation in just 3 days using a dust-free process. The floor was ready to walk on immediately after installation. Most residential jarrah flooring projects take between 2–5 days.&lt;/p&gt; 
  &lt;/div&gt; 
  &lt;div class="lw-faq-item"&gt; 
   &lt;div class="lw-faq-q"&gt;
     Is jarrah an Australian native timber? 
   &lt;/div&gt; 
   &lt;p class="lw-faq-a"&gt;Yes — jarrah (Eucalyptus marginata) is a native Australian hardwood found exclusively in the south-western corner of Western Australia. It is one of Australia's most iconic and prized timbers, known for its deep red hue, exceptional hardness, natural termite resistance, and remarkable longevity. Many jarrah floors installed over a century ago remain in excellent condition today.&lt;/p&gt;
